Tombstone of Maria Lauterer, Marta Lauterer and Samuel Przyszecki

Burial place marked by a cast-iron cross, in front of which an oblique gravestone on a base. Cross with arms terminating in floral motifs. At the intersection of the arms of the cross a granite plaque with an engraved inscription (1), on the back a cast inscription (2). The slab closed with a segmental arch, on it an engraved cross, below it an engraved inscription (3).
Inscription:
(1) Hier ruhlin Gott / Maria Lauterer gebarn Apfelbaum / Mutter von Knajensky, / geb. d. 28 März 1841, gest. d. 8. Marz 1903. //.
(2) Erbbegräbnis von Frau / Marta Lauterer //.
(3) Samuel Przyszecki / Witebsk: Gub: Pttu Lepelsk / Ur: 1818. r. 11 Lutego / Um. 1883 [.][3] Maja //.
Time of origin:
1883-1885
Lokalizacja nagrobka:
Sector number 3 Tomb number 9
Dimensions:
155 x 100 x 5 cm
Materials:
coloured magmatic rocks (granite, syenite and others), cast iron
Additional Information about materials:
cast iron cross
Additional information:
St Michael's cemetery in Riga, as of 2021.
State of preservation:
rust
Comments on the state of preservation and visible restoration:
later cross (ca. 1903)
